Kingdom of Heaven is a 2005 historical epic directed by Ridley Scott that explores the Crusades-era conflict around Jerusalem through the eyes of Balian of Ibelin, a French blacksmith-turned-knight (played by Orlando Bloom). The film combines large-scale battle sequences, political and religious tensions, and questions about leadership, faith, and coexistence.
